Transaction e3834dd55ed12c42f0f83609d959af53e22d6277f39a7e49453f11b67207201d
1 Input
1 Output
-
e3834dd55ed12c42f0f83609d959af53e22d6277f39a7e49453f11b67207201d:0
- value
- 964693
- script pubkey
- OP_0 OP_PUSHBYTES_20 28a915344791ddf33d4d6e04a1a6e5ed8b4ba9aa
- address
- bc1q9z532dz8j8wlx02ddcz2rfh9ak95h2d2ydl5pm